When taking Robitussin DM, it is crucial to follow these precautions: adhere to the recommended dosage, as overuse can lead to side effects; avoid alcohol while taking the medication; consult with a healthcare provider if you have conditions like chronic bronchitis or asthma, or if you are pregnant or breastfeeding; and keep in mind potential drug interactions, specifically with MAO inhibitors or other cough medicines.

- Can I drink alcohol while taking Robitussin DM? It is recommended to avoid alcohol while taking Robitussin DM, as it can increase the risk of serious side effects.
- What should I do if I have asthma or chronic bronchitis and need to take Robitussin DM? Consult your healthcare provider before using Robitussin DM if you have asthma or chronic bronchitis to ensure it is safe for you.
- Are there any drug interactions to be aware of with Robitussin DM? Yes, Robitussin DM may interact with MAO inhibitors and other cough medicines, so always check with your doctor or pharmacist before combining medications.
